Scanned & Vectorized Contours


Overview

ADCi's 1:24,000 scale digital contours are scanned from exisitng U.S. Geological Survey mylar separates. Each contour line has an elevation (Z) value attribute represented in feet. Tic marks are included to represent corner points of original map. There are no crossing or merging contours except at the map boundary. U.S. Geological Survey 1:100,000 scale maps provide the digital source for this ADCi intermediate-scale map. Contours are edge-matched across 7.5 minute quadrangle boundaries within 30 x 60 minutes regions. The contour map will overlay ADCi's Cornerstone DLG to provide good registration with water and roads.
